#53901c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53901c is composed of 32.5% red, 56.5%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.6%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 91.6 degrees, a saturation of 67.4% and a lightness of 33.7%. #53901c color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ff38 with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#53901c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#53901c has RGB values of R:83, G:144,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 5476380.

Shades and Tints of #53901c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070d02 is the darkest color, while #fdfefb is the lightest one.
